bgp bestpath as-path ignore
Ignore the AS PATH in BGP best path calculations.
Syntax
bgp bestpath as-path ignore
To return to the default, enter the no bgp bestpath as-path ignore
command.
Defaults Disabled (that is, the software considers the AS_PATH when choosing a route as
best).
Command Modes ROUTER BGP
Supported Modes Full–Switch

Usage Information If you enable this command, use the clear ip bgp * command to recompute
the best path.
bgp bestpath as-path multipath-relax
Include prefixes received from different AS paths during multipath calculation.
Syntax
bgp bestpath as-path multipath-relax
To return to the default BGP routing process, use the no bgp bestpath as-
path multipath-relax command.
Defaults Disabled
Command Modes ROUTER BGP
Supported Modes Full–Switch
